# Approvals: Legacy ORM Refactor

Support team: the Brackenline ORM layer is being refactored in phases. Any schema-touching hotfix now requires pre-approval. File a request with the affected tables; turnaround is one business day. Emergency patches still need retroactive review within 48 hours. All approvals are issued by the engineer named below.

named custodian: Brivan Eliath Quenox Frador

## Step 4: Swap the scanner hooks

Okay, this is the fiddly bit. In Quintel 3.x the barcode scanner events come through `onScanBatch` instead of firing one event per beep, so your plugin needs to unpack the array. If you were debouncing manually, stop — the Quintel runtime does it now and double-debouncing eats scans. Register your handler before calling `scanner.attach()`, or nothing arrives. Once that's wired, point your dev build at our sandbox. The sandbox settings you'll need are right below.

settings of kagag-kagef:
[kelath]
port = 9300
region = west-4
host = kelath.olvarqworks.example
team = sorion
timeout_ms = 1000
retries = 8

## Consent Banner Rollout — Escalation

If the Noticeboard banner stops rendering mid-rollout, don't panic and don't flip the kill switch right away — check the Gatewick flag service first, since a stuck flag looks identical to a client bug. Roll back the flag percentage to the last known-good value and watch render rates for ten minutes. Still broken? Grab a session trace and loop in the privacy engineering crew.

escalation mailbox, bafog-fafog: ulador@paliqlabs.internal